Maggie White of Herculeia Consulting has international experience in delivering human support services to a wide range of service user and stakeholder groups. She has advised and worked in both the Not-for-Profit and Government sectors. Her work includes designing and delivering programmes, leading teams and above all finding and developing new ways to address old problems.

Her systemic approach combined with her skills in recovery and leadership mean that the successful outcomes often endure far beyond the funding cycle. They impact on many more people than just direct service recipients. They also lead to high levels of staff achievement and satisfaction.

She is passionate about bringing an integrated and strategic approach to the challenges people and organisations face. She draws on her systemic and cultural awareness backgrounds underpinned by sustainable business-based thinking. The dialogue processes she uses can draw out deep and innovative thinking from across the organisation.

Examples of her work include:

  • Turning around an agency that was on the brink of being de-funded due to perceived poor performance and within a year enabling it to be regarded as a leader across several sectors
  • Mentoring a Norwegian agency working with distressed youth with multiple diagnoses and their families - enabling staff to work with increased confidence and success
  • Pioneering family reconciliation work with young service users in the Drug and Alcohol sector in Western Australia and achieving significant and enduring change within short time frames
  • Designing programmes and mentoring local people to deliver services that address family violence, child neglect and restore community cohesion in remote communities in Australia
  • Consulting to agencies in the UK and Australia on implementing Social Return on Investment evaluations which substantiate value for money claims
